All Rise (2019)

Overview

A look at the personal and professional lives of the judges, lawyers, clerks, bailiffs and cops who work at an L.A. County courthouse.

Detailed Bias Analysis

Analyzing...
Progressive

Primary

The series consistently critiques systemic biases and disparities within the justice system, advocating for solutions rooted in empathy, equity, and progressive reform, which aligns with left-leaning discourse.

The series prominently features a diverse main cast, led by a Black woman in a powerful judicial role, reflecting intentional DEI-driven casting. Its narrative frequently addresses and critiques systemic injustices, racial biases, and socio-economic disparities within the legal system, making these themes central to its storytelling.

Secondary

All Rise features multiple LGBTQ+ characters whose identities are integrated naturally into the narrative. Their relationships are depicted with dignity and complexity, facing common life challenges rather than those tied to their queer identity in a problematic way. The show consistently portrays these characters with agency and respect, contributing to a net positive impact.

All Rise features transsexual characters in significant storylines, including a recurring judge who comes out as a trans man and a trans woman seeking justice after a hate crime. The show consistently portrays these characters with dignity and agency, framing obstacles as external prejudice. Protagonists champion supportive, empathetic responses, resulting in a net positive portrayal of trans identities and experiences.

The series often features characters who identify as Christian, portraying their faith as a source of moral guidance, community, or personal strength. Any negative actions by Christian characters are typically framed as individual failings rather than a critique of the religion itself, with the narrative often promoting understanding and empathy.
